Catherine O’Hara, Beloved Comedy Icon, Passes Away at 71
Catherine O’Hara, the celebrated Canadian actress and comedian, passed away at the age of 71. Her death occurred on January 30 at her residence in Los Angeles. O’Hara was known for her unique comedic talents that ranged from delightfully silly to charmingly eccentric.
Catherine O’Hara’s Iconic Career
O’Hara became a household name through various memorable roles. She captivated audiences in classic films, including:
- Beetlejuice
- Home Alone
In recent years, she gained immense popularity as the self-absorbed matriarch in the acclaimed television series “Schitt’s Creek.” Her portrayal earned her a new generation of fans.
Legacy and Tributes
The Creative Artists Agency, which represented O’Hara, confirmed her passing in a statement. They noted that she died after a brief illness, but specific details were not disclosed. O’Hara’s legacy as a beloved comedy icon will remain in the hearts of her fans and peers alike.
